• ベストアンサー

読み難く歪められた文字列の候補

Captcha認証の文字列を文字列として自動的にPCが認識してくれ得ない、という事情を踏まえまして、読み取らせる画像的な文字列は画像の状態で「最初から」準備されているのだろう、と考えたのですが、その認識は謬見なのでしょうか?

質問者が選んだベストアンサー

  • ベストアンサー
  • jjon-com
  • ベストアンサー率61% (1599/2592)
回答No.1

画像が最初から用意されているもののありますし,毎回適当に決めた認証文字列から画像を生成するものもあります。 > Captcha認証の文字列を文字列として自動的に > PCが認識してくれ得ない、という事情を踏まえまして、 そのような事情と,画像の事前準備とは関係ないんじゃないでしょうか。 例えば,   文字列 CAPTCHA → 歪んだ画像 2d91cbf の生成は PCで簡単にできるけれど,   文字列 CAPTCHA ← 歪んだ画像 2d91cbf の逆変換は PCにとって難しい。 のであれば,サーバ側のプログラムは,毎回適当に決めた認証文字列から,   文字列 BUFFALO → 歪んだ画像 23b2723 を生成して,利用者がパスコードの入力を終えるまではその対応づけをサーバ側で覚えておけばいいだけです。

BuffaloAndJtp
質問者

補足

有り難う御座います。 非常に良く分かりました。

関連するQ&A